Applies ToAccess для Microsoft 365 Access 2024 Access 2021 Access 2019 Access 2016

Щоб зробити вказаний запис поточним у відкритій таблиці, формі або наборі результатів запиту, у локальній базі даних Access чи веб-програмі Access можна скористатися макросом "Перейтидозапису".

Настройка

У настільних базах даних Access макрос Перейтидозапису має такі аргументи.

Аргумент дії

Опис

Тип об’єкта

Тип об’єкта, що містить запис, який потрібно зробити поточним. Виберіть пункт Таблиця, Запит, Форма, Подання сервера, Збережена процедура або Функція в полі Тип об’єкта. Залиште цей аргумент пустим, щоб вибрати активний об’єкт.

Ім’я об’єкта

Ім’я об’єкта, що містить запис, який потрібно перетворити на поточний запис. У полі Ім’я об’єкта відображаються всі об’єкти поточної бази даних типу, вибраного за допомогою аргументу Тип об’єкта. Якщо аргумент Тип об’єкта не задано, залиште цей аргумент пустим.

Запис

Запис, який потрібно зробити поточним. Виберіть пункт Назад, Далі, З початку, З кінця, Перейти до або Новий у полі Запис. Значення за замовчуванням – Наступний.

Зсув

Ціле число або вираз, який повертає ціле число. Виразу має передувати знак рівності (=). У цьому аргументі вказується запис, який потрібно зробити з поточним записом. Аргумент Зсув можна використовувати двома способами:

  • Коли аргумент Запис має значення Наступний або Попередній, програма Access виконує перехід на таку кількість записів вперед або назад, яку вказано в аргументі Зсув.

  • Якщо аргумент "Запис" має значення "Перейти", Access переходить до запису з числом, рівним аргументу "Зсув ". Номер запису відображається в поле номера запису внизу вікна.

Примітка.: Якщо для аргументу Запис використовується значення Перший, Останній або Новий, програма Access не враховує аргумент Зсув. Якщо ввести завеликий аргумент Зсув, у програмі Access з’явиться повідомлення про помилку. Для аргументу Зсув не можна вводити від’ємні числа.

У веб-програмах Access макрос Перейтидозапису має лише один аргумент.

Аргумент дії

Опис

Запис

Запис, який потрібно зробити поточним. Виберіть пункт Назад, Далі, З початку або З кінця в полі Запис. Значення за замовчуванням – Далі.

Примітки

Якщо фокус установлено на певному елементі керування в записі, після виконання цієї дії макросу він залишиться на тому самому елементі керування в новому записі.

Для аргументу Запис можна використати настройку Новий, щоб перейти до пустого запису в кінці форми або таблиці, де можна ввести нові дані.

У локальних базах даних Access ця дія схожа на натискання стрілки під кнопкою Знайти на вкладці Основне та натискання кнопки Перейти. Підкоманди "Перший", "Останній", "Наступний", "Попередній" і "Новий запис" команди "Перейти" мають такий самий вплив на вибраний об'єкт, що й для аргументу "Перший", "Останній", "Далі", "Попередній" і "Створити". Також можна перейти до записів, використовуючи навігаційні кнопки у нижній частині вікна.

У локальних базах даних Access за допомогою макросу Перейтидозапису можна зробити запис у прихованій формі поточного запису, якщо в аргументах Тип об’єкта та Ім’я об’єкта вказано приховану форму.

Щоб виконати дію Перейтидозапису в модулі Visual Basic for Applications (VBA), скористайтеся методом FindRecord об’єкта DoCmd.

Потрібна додаткова довідка?

Потрібні додаткові параметри?

Ознайомтеся з перевагами передплати, перегляньте навчальні курси, дізнайтесь, як захистити свій пристрій тощо.

Спільноти допомагають ставити запитання й відповідати на них, надавати відгуки та дізнаватися думки висококваліфікованих експертів.